Thank God I arrived at Sai Ying Pun area safely.
I decided to go to Grassroots Pantry. This restaurant is already on my places that I have to visit list. I'm choosing this restaurant for my last stop because it has interesting concept and have a beautiful interior. Grassroots Pantry is a vegetarian restaurant serving wholesome organic food. I'm not a vegetarian, but I love eating healthy and they serve delicious healthy food. Not only delivering good food, Grassroots Pantry also pay attention to good hospitality and giving full restaurant experience to the customer.
From the moment I arrived at this place, I feel happy and proud of myself. I say to myself, "Hey, you make it without getting lost." I believe if our desire is greater than our fear, then we can make it as long as we try. When I arrived at Grassroots Pantry, this restaurant was still closed, so I took photo from the outside first. You can see green plants on the outside and some chairs for you to wait to be seated. Inside, you can see vintage furniture and cute decoration complementing the looks. Now Grassroots Pantry moves to their new home in Hollywood Road. This photo is the one taken in Fuk Sau Lane, but they closed this place already. Their new home is more clean lines, but their signature rustic and homey feel remains true in every corner.
